Development of 2,6-carboxy-substituted boron dipyrromethene (BODIPY) as a novel scaffold of ratiometric fluorescent probes for live cell imaging.

Toru Komatsu1, Yasuteru Urano, Yuuta Fujikawa, Tomonori Kobayashi, Hirotatsu Kojima, Takuya Terai, Kenjiro Hanaoka, Tetsuo Nagano.   

Abstract

Ratiometric fluorescent probes based on boron dipyrromethene (BODIPY) were developed based on a novel design strategy, in which a change of the electron-withdrawing character of the 2,6-substituents resulting from reaction with a target molecule generates a fluorescence wavelength change.
